Controversy Surrounds Bill Belichick and Jordon Hudson’s Relationship
Chapel Hill, North Carolina — Jordon Hudson, the girlfriend of North Carolina Tar Heels head coach Bill Belichick, recently made headlines during a game against Stanford. Hudson was spotted on the sidelines wearing a necklace that read, ‘Banned,’ stirring up controversy surrounding the couple’s relationship.
The attention around Hudson and Belichick intensified after a challenging CBS interview promoting the coach’s latest book. Back in May, reports claimed that Hudson was allegedly prohibited from participating in the program, but North Carolina athletic director Bubba Cunningham denied any restrictions, stating that Hudson was not barred from the stadium.
Hudson’s presence at the game was a clear statement, especially after North Carolina’s victory over Stanford, bringing their season record to 4-5. Despite early-season struggles, the team showed promise with nearly winning games against the California Golden Bears and Virginia Cavaliers.
During Saturday’s game, North Carolina quarterback Gio Lopez completed 18 of 25 passes for 203 yards and threw two touchdowns. One of his scoring passes was a 55-yarder to Jordan Shipp, who led the team with five receptions for 83 yards. After the win, Belichick expressed his satisfaction, saying, ‘Good win. Good to win at home. Always good to win at home. Proud of our team.’
With three games remaining against Duke and North Carolina State, the Tar Heels are looking to improve their position as the season approaches its conclusion.
